Truth Values
The validity status of a statement, which can be either true or false in classical logic.
Truth Table
A mathematical table used in logic to compute the truth values of logical expressions based on their truth values of their components.
Atomic Sentences
Simple sentences that contain no logical connectives or only one predicate that asserts something about a subject.
Short Form Truth Table
A method used in logical analysis to determine the validity of logical statements by systematically examining all possible truth values of its components in a concise format.
